Martinsburg, IA Local Guide

Largest Available Martinsburg and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Martinsburg, IA is found at The Hunt Club in the Old Mill Creek neighborhood and is 1,391 square feet priced from $1,775. Spaulding Lofts in the East Gate Estates ne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,362 square feet and currently listed start at $950. Cheapest Available Martinsburg and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of July 30,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Martinsburg, IA is the 2B1B Model starting from $470 at The Reserves at South Lake in the East Gate Estates neighborhood. The second most affordable Martinsburg 2 Bedroom is the Two Bedroom Model at Louden Lofts starting at $800 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Martinsburg is currently $1,270.
